Complete Biography and Profile: Megan Mullally & Nick Offerman

Before diving into the secrets of their long-lasting marriage, it’s essential to understand the powerhouse careers of the two individuals who make up this comedic duo. Their individual successes laid the groundwork for a partnership of equals.

Megan Mullally: The Iconic Karen Walker

  • Full Name: Megan Faye Mullally
  • Born: November 12, 1958, in Los Angeles, California
  • Education: Graduated from Northwestern University.
  • Key Roles: Karen Walker on *Will & Grace* (1998–2006, 2017–2020), Chief on *Childrens Hospital*, Tammy II on *Parks and Recreation*.
  • Awards & Recognition: She received eight Primetime Emmy Award nominations for *Will & Grace*, winning twice (2000 and 2006) for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Comedy Series. She also won three Screen Actors Guild Awards.
  • Previous Marriages: James Thomas Hines (m. 1982; div. 1987) and Michael Katcher (m. 1992; div. 1996).

Nick Offerman: The Beloved Ron Swanson

  • Full Name: Nicholas David Offerman
  • Born: June 26, 1970, in Joliet, Illinois
  • Education: Graduated from the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ign.
  • Key Roles: Ron Swanson on the NBC sitcom *Parks and Recreation* (2009–2015), Bill in *The Last of Us*, Karl Weathers in *Fargo*.
  • Other Ventures: He is a successful writer (author of multiple books), woodworker, and humorist, known for his deadpan comedic style.
  • Awards & Recognition: Known for his work on *Parks and Recreation* for which he received the Television Critics Association Award. He also co-hosted the 37th Film Independent Spirit Awards with Megan.

The Relationship Timeline: How Megan Mullally and Nick Offerman Met

The couple’s relationship began in 2000, a time when Megan was already a major star on *Will & Grace* and Nick was still building his career. Their initial meeting was not on a grand Hollywood set, but in a much more down-to-earth setting—a play called *The Berlin Circle* at the Evidence Room Theatre Company in Los Angeles.

The 12-Year Age Difference: Megan is 12 years Nick’s senior, a fact they often joke about, but one that has clearly had no bearing on the strength of their connection. They began dating shortly after meeting and quickly realized they were soulmates.

The Surprise Wedding of 2003: After three years of dating, Megan and Nick tied the knot in a now-famous surprise wedding. The event, held at their home in Hollywood on September 20, 2003, was disguised as a pre-Emmys party. Guests, including Nick’s *Parks and Recreation* co-star Amy Poehler and *Will & Grace* co-stars Debra Messing and Eric McCormack, arrived expecting a casual gathering, only to find themselves at a wedding ceremony.

This spontaneous, intimate approach to their nuptials set the tone for their entire marriage: unconventional, fun, and focused on their own happiness rather than Hollywood expectations. Their marriage date of September 20, 2003, means they have been married for over 22 years as of late 2025.

Their Unconventional Secrets to a Long-Lasting Hollywood Marriage

In a town notorious for short-lived relationships, the longevity of the Mullally-Offerman marriage is a constant source of fascination. They have been open about their "secrets," which are less about grand gestures and more about practical, humorous, and deeply committed partnership.

1. The "We Just Really Like Each Other" Philosophy

When asked about the key to their 25-year relationship (dating and marriage), Nick Offerman's consistent answer is simple: "We just really like each other, which I highly recommend if you're going to get married." This mutual affection goes beyond love; it's a deep, abiding friendship that makes spending time together genuinely enjoyable. Their relationship is rooted in being each other's favorite person.

2. The Power of "In Bed with Nick and Megan" (The Podcast)

One of the freshest updates on the couple is their joint podcast, *In Bed with Nick and Megan*. Launched in 2019, the show gives listeners an intimate, unscripted look into their daily lives, conversations, and relationship dynamics. The podcast, which they describe as "talking, singing, and sex acts" (jokingly, of course), is a testament to their willingness to share their private life and work together creatively, keeping their connection fresh and collaborative.

3. Maintaining Independent Success and Shared Projects

While they are a unit, both Megan and Nick have maintained wildly successful, independent careers. Megan continues to be an in-demand comedic actress, while Nick has expanded his career into dramatic roles (like the critically acclaimed *The Last of Us*), writing, and his passion for woodworking.

However, they frequently find ways to collaborate, which serves as a relationship booster. Their joint projects include:

  • Parks and Recreation: Megan played Tammy II, one of Ron Swanson's famously chaotic ex-wives.
  • Will & Grace: Nick appeared as a plumber.
  • The Umbrella Academy: They are set to join the cast for the final fourth season, a highly anticipated 2025 project.
  • Stage Shows: They have toured with their comedy-variety show, *Summer of 69*, and are scheduled to appear together at *Vivid Sydney 2025*.
  • Film Roles: They have appeared together in *A Very Harold & Kumar Christmas*, *Speaking of Sex*, and *Stealing Harvard*.

4. The Importance of Separate Time (The 2-Week Rule)

Despite their frequent collaborations, the couple has an unwritten rule about not spending more than two weeks apart. This simple boundary ensures they prioritize their relationship and reconnect frequently, preventing the long stretches of separation that often plague celebrity marriages due to demanding filming schedules. This intentional effort to stay close is a cornerstone of their enduring bond.

5. No Children, No Regrets

Megan and Nick have been very candid about their decision not to have children. They both realized early in their relationship that they did not have a "burning desire" to have kids. This mutual agreement and freedom from societal expectations allowed them to focus completely on their partnership and their careers, removing a major source of potential conflict and pressure that many couples face.
